Common questions about WPS Cell Styles on macOS usually involve editing styles, display results, and reuse across worksheets; this section covers 3 frequent questions.
FAQ
How do I modify an existing style?
- Open the Cell Styles list from the Home tab.
- Find the style that you want to adjust.
- Right-click the style, select Modify, and then update the formatting settings.
Why does the applied style look different from what I expected?
- Check the original number format, border, fill, or related settings in the target cells.
- Apply another style for comparison.
- If you need a fixed result, create a custom cell style and define each formatting item clearly.
Can I reuse a custom style in other spreadsheets?
- Make sure the custom style has already been saved in the style list.
- In the target cell range, open the Cell Styles list again.
- Select the saved style and apply it.
Glossary
| Term | Definition |
|---|---|
| Cell Style | A formatting set that combines font, border, fill, number format, and related cell settings. |
| Style Gallery | The list area that stores preset and custom styles for direct application. |
| Custom Cell Style | A user-defined formatting combination saved for repeated use later. |
